Welcome aboard 212, an excellently maintained and exceptionally clean Sunseeker Manhattan 73 - 2014. This stunning motoryacht features a four-stateroom layout, providing comfort for up to eight guests and two crew members (one crew cabin and crew head). All services and maintenance have been entirely performed to keep her in excellent condition, both aesthetically and technically. Numerous upgrades performed in 2022 and 2023 have been undertaken, and they are listed below. At the stern, you'll find a comfortable stateroom equipped to host two crew members. The spacious interior is enhanced by large hull-side windows, allowing natural light to flood the modern-styled living spaces.
Below deck, the Sunseeker Manhattan 73 boasts a full-beam master stateroom with large windows, a desk, and a couch. This large space includes a walk-in closet and a luxuriously finished bathroom. Moving forward, the vessel accommodates a twin cabin on the port side and a spacious storage room. Mid-ship on the starboard side, there is a guest cabin with a floating queen and a bathroom that also serves as the day head, accessible from the hallway. At the forefront is the VIP cabin with its own bathroom and a floating queen bed, illuminated by plenty of natural light streaming through the large windows in all cabins. Cruising Speed:20kn
Max Speed:28kn
Range:325nm
Nominal Length:73ft
Length Overall:74.17ft
Max Draft:5.33ft
Beam:18.83ft
Dry Weight:98,780Lb
Fresh Water Tanks:314gal
Fuel Tanks:1321gal
Holding Tanks:49gal
Cabins:4
Heads:3
Engine Make:MAN
Engine Model:V12-1360
Engine Year:2014
Total Power:1360hp
Engine Hours:1750
Engine Type:inboard
Drive Type:direct
Fuel Type:diesel
